Overall Meaning

The lyrics of George Shearing's song "September in the Rain" speak of a love that once was, in a time and place where memories of it are associated with the rainy month of September. The first verse describes how the leaves of brown are falling down, a sign of change and the passage of time. The second line "remember, in September, in the rain" reflects how memories are often anchored in certain times and places. The next line, "the sun went out just like a dying ember," paints a picture of a fading love or a relationship that has come to an end. The phrase "that September in the rain" is repeated often throughout the song, emphasizing the significance of this particular month and the rain that accompanied it.


The second verse continues with the theme of love and memories, with the singer recalling the words of love that were whispered to them, set against the backdrop of raindrops playing a sweet refrain. The lyrics suggest a bittersweet nostalgia, as even though spring has arrived, for the singer, it's still September in their heart. The final line "that September that brought the pain" is particularly poignant, as it highlights how memories of love can be intertwined with feelings of sadness or loss.


Overall, "September in the Rain" is a poignant song that expresses the universal experience of love and loss. Through its evocative lyrics and melody, it captures the emotions and associations that we can have with certain times and places, and how they can continue to stay with us long after the moment has passed.
